  • Abstract
    This paper is a contribution to the open boundary axisymmetric quasi-static magnetic field problems in the presence of eddy currents. A hybrid method is developed combining the finite-element method inside an inner region with a special boundary-element method for the outer region based on an analytical treatment. Spherical coordinates become appropriate due to the consideration of spherical surfaces separating the inner and outer regions.
